What is a roof tile scraper?
A roof tile scraper is a tool specifically designed to remove old, damaged, or unwanted roof tiles. It typically consists of a long handle and a sharp, flat blade that can easily slide under the tiles and lift them up. Roof tile scrapers come in various shapes and sizes, but they all serve the same essential purpose: to make roof maintenance easier and more efficient.
How Does a roof tile scraper Work?
Using a roof tile scraper is a relatively straightforward process, but it does require some caution and attention to detail. To use a roof tile scraper effectively, start by positioning the blade of the scraper under the tile you want to remove. Then, apply gentle pressure to lift the tile up and away from the roof. Be careful not to damage the surrounding tiles or the underlying structure of the roof.

Tips for Using a Roof Tile Scraper Safely
While roof tile scrapers are invaluable tools, they can also be dangerous if not used correctly. Here are some tips for using a roof tile scraper safely:
1. Wear Protective Gear: To protect yourself from cuts and injuries, always wear gloves and safety goggles when using a roof tile scraper.
2. Use Caution: Roof tile scrapers have sharp blades that can easily damage your roof or cause injury if not used carefully. Take your time and pay attention to what you are doing to avoid accidents.
3. Don’t Force It: If a tile is not coming up easily, do not force it with the roof tile scraper. Instead, reassess your technique and try again, or seek help from a professional if necessary.
